Find all possible radii of circle centered at (3,6) so that the circle intersects only one axis

Answers

Answered by MathMate
The distance of the centre from the y-axis is 3, and that from the x-axis is 6.
We therefore require that the radius be more than 3 and up to 6, assuming the interpretation of "intersection" excludes tangency.
so 3<r≤6
